Methods for Locating Buried Sprinkler Heads
There are several methods you can employ to locate buried sprinkler heads, ranging from simple, low-tech approaches to more sophisticated, technologically driven techniques.
Visual Inspection and Mapping
One of the first steps in locating buried sprinkler heads is to conduct a thorough visual inspection of the lawn. Look for slight depressions or different grass colors that might indicate the presence of a sprinkler head. If you have access to the original installation maps or diagrams of the sprinkler system, these can be invaluable in pinpointing the locations. Creating or updating a map of your sprinkler system as you locate each head can save you a lot of time and headache in the future.
Using Probing Tools
A more hands-on approach involves using a probing tool, such as a sharp, thin stick or a professional sprinkler probe, to gently feel for the heads. This method requires care to avoid damaging the sprinkler components or pipes. Start by probing areas where you suspect a head might be based on the system’s layout and the watering patterns you’ve observed.
Watering System Activation
Activating the sprinkler system and observing where water pops up is a straightforward way to locate buried heads. However, this method might not be practical if you’re trying to locate a specific head that’s not functioning properly, as a non-operational head won’t produce water. Nonetheless, it’s a useful technique for getting a general idea of where the active heads are located.
Technological Aids
For more complex systems or when other methods prove ineffective, technological tools can be employed. Devices like metal detectors can help locate the metal components of the sprinkler heads, although their effectiveness can be limited by the depth of the heads and the presence of other metal objects in the ground. Specialized detection equipment designed specifically for locating underground irrigation components is available and can be very effective, though it may require a significant investment.
Precautions and Considerations
When attempting to locate buried sprinkler heads, it’s essential to take certain precautions to avoid damaging the system, other underground utilities, or the lawn itself.
Avoiding Damage
- Be cautious with digging tools to avoid hitting pipes or the sprinkler heads themselves.
- Use non-invasive methods whenever possible to minimize disturbance to the lawn and reduce the risk of damaging underground components.
- Mark areas where you suspect sprinkler heads are located to avoid accidentally digging in those spots.
Legal and Safety Considerations
Before you start digging, check with local utility companies to ensure you’re not going to interfere with any underground cables, gas lines, or water mains. This is a critical safety measure that can prevent serious accidents. Additionally, be aware of any local regulations or homeowners’ association rules that might govern lawn digging or sprinkler system modifications.

What are some common challenges when locating buried sprinkler heads?
One of the most significant challenges when locating buried sprinkler heads is interference from other metal objects or system components. This can include things like pipes, wires, or other underground features, which can confuse or overwhelm the detection signal. Additionally, the presence of dense soil, rocks, or other subsurface obstacles can Make it difficult or impossible to detect the sprinkler head, even with specialized equipment. Other challenges may include the age or condition of the system, as older or deteriorated components can be harder to detect, and the complexity of the system design, which can make it difficult to interpret detection results.
To overcome these challenges, individuals may need to use a combination of detection methods, or to employ more advanced equipment, such as ground-penetrating radar. It is also important to be patient and meticulous, working slowly and systematically to scan the area and pinpoint the location of the buried sprinkler heads. In some cases, it may be necessary to excavate the area carefully, using a probe or digging tool to gently uncover the sprinkler head and confirm its location. By being aware of these potential challenges and taking steps to address them, individuals can increase their chances of success and achieve a more accurate and efficient location process.
